如何在Visual Studio中组合两个依赖项目

时间:2017-10-08 16:50:47

标签: visual-studio mfc

我有一个有两个项目的解决方案。一个是静态链接库项目,另一个是用于演示的控制台项目。现在我想创建一个MFC项目来替换控制台项目,我该怎么做才能配置MFC项目。

  1. MFC项目需要在.lib项目中使用一些类。
  2. 我已将MFC项目设置为启动项目,并依赖于.lib项目。
  3. 我的平台是win7 + vs2015。
  4. 实际上,解决方案是EasyPR,您可以在此处EasyPR
  5. 感谢您的帮助。

1 个答案:

答案 0 :(得分:1)

将依赖项设置为静态库只需一步。

要编译代码,您可能需要编译器的标头。因此,MFC项目可能需要编译器的设置来定义其他包含路径。

您仍需要配置要使用的链接器并查找库。要引用该库,您可以使用pragma注释库。在链接器设置中,您可以为库添加其他路径。

或者您可以将lib拖到解决方案资源管理器中。构建机制将知道如何处理lib并将其包含在构建过​​程中。如果你有1个lib用于发布和调试,那么后者才有效。

如果您有不同的发布和调试库,建议您使用不同的名称。您可以调整MFC程序的项目设置以进行不同的调试和发布。